This is a canned message. Please read it carefully and save it
for future reference.
This list is intended to disseminate timely ticket information,
setlists, and miscellaneous "important" stuff about the Grateful
Dead. Discussion, questions, and long rambling reviews are not
welcome here. The goal is to allow busy people to stay in touch.
Volume should not go beyond 2-3 messages per week on average.
Please limit any postings to purely factual information that is
likely to be of general interest. In particular, ticket bartering
does not belong here. If you need tickets for a sold-out show,
join Dead-Flames or read rec.music.gdead (see below).
This list is semi-moderated -- there is a small group of people
who are allowed to post directly. Postings from anyone else go
to the service address for evaluation. If they fit the charter
they are forwarded on. If they do not, I usually delete them
without comment.
The USENET newsgoup rec.music.gdead is a free-for-all forum for
Grateful Dead fans. It contains LOTS of other stuff.
If you have questions, if you want to meet people, if you're
interested in anything remotely Dead-related, if you want to read
A LOT articles, join that one.
